Grasping Registered Agents
Registered agent services play a key role in the formation and maintenance of various business entities, including LLCs and corporate structures. Basically, a registered agent serves as the official point of contact between the business and the state, ensuring that all legal documents and correspondence are properly handled. This includes receiving service of process, legal notices, and tax-related paperwork, which are vital for adhering with state regulations.
Selecting the appropriate registered agent can significantly affect your business's security and legal standing. Business owners should take into account factors such as dependability, affordability, and local availability when choosing a registered agent services. A professional registered agent not only assists fulfill registered agent obligations but also offers extra services like annual compliance filings and business mail handling, which can greatly simplify your administrative responsibilities.

Pricing and Charges of Registered Agent Solutions
The cost of registered agent solutions can vary considerably based on multiple factors, including the provider's standing, the included services, and location. Generally, you can expect to pay anywhere from $50 to $500 per year for registered agent solutions. This spectrum generally covers both basic services and more comprehensive packages that may feature additional services such as annual compliance services and business mail handling.

Legal Compliance and Compliance Requirements
When launching a business, understanding regulatory and legal obligations is vital for guaranteeing that your business operates legally. One of the key aspects is the selection of a legal representative. A registered agent serves as the official point of liaison between your business and the state, accepting important legal documents, such as tax forms and legal notifications. The function of the registered agent is not only to provide a dependable method of correspondence with the state, but also to help maintain your business's compliance.
Each region has specific registered agent regulations that companies must adhere to. Typically, the registered agent must be a inhabitant of the region or a company authorized to conduct business there. This means if you operate a business in various states, you'll need to ensure compliance with each state's designated agent requirements. Additionally, registered agents have responsibilities that include forwarding important documents to business owners and making sure that yearly submissions are filed on time.

Benefits of Qualified Registered Agents
Engaging a professional designated agent provides business owners with a considerable advantage in ensuring adherence with state regulations. These agents are well-versed in the designated agent requirements for various states and can navigate the nuances of legal obligations. By transferring these responsibilities, entrepreneurs can focus on growth and operational management rather than the intricacies of statutory compliance.
A dependable designated agent also enhances corporate privacy. Using a registered agent service allows entrepreneurs to keep their personal addresses confidential, as the designated agent's address is listed in public records. This added layer of privacy helps protect entrepreneurs from unwanted solicitations and enhances overall security when handling confidential legal documents.

Altering Your Registered Agent
Altering your registered agent is a key step for any business owner wishing to ensure compliance and ensure seamless operations. The process typically begins with finding a new registered agent provider that meets your needs, whether you are seeking the best registered agent services or cost-effective options. It is essential to choose a dependable registered agent who can satisfy the statutory requirements and provide the essential services, such as business mail handling and agent for service of process.
Once you have selected a new registered agent, the subsequent step involves filing the appropriate change registered agent form to your state’s business filing agency. This paperwork usually requires details about your business, the current registered agent, and the new registered agent. Always check the registered agent state requirements as they can vary by jurisdiction. Some states may also require a written consent from the new registered agent, verifying their willingness to take on the position.
After the change has been completed, ensure that you receive acknowledgment, such as a registered agent certificate or an official notice from the state.
